**09:47 — Autoscaler goes sideways.** Our queue-depth autoscaler on the Glimmerpond workers started flapping: it scaled up on a depth spike, drained the queue instantly, then scaled to zero and repeated. New folks, this is why we added the cooldown window. Nobody paged because alerts averaged out. The misbehaving autoscaler build is identified by the token below.

build token for yajof-bajof: htk31_506ff1188f74596b5bb2eec94edc43c

LEADERSHIP BRIEFING — Inventory Write-Down

Board review item. We are writing down 1.8M of Kestrel-line components held at the Darrowfield warehouse. Cause: obsolescence following the Kestrel 4 redesign and a cancelled order from Murnave Industrial. Impact: Q4 gross margin down roughly two points. Mitigation: salvage sale of usable stock, tightened procurement triggers, quarterly obsolescence reviews from January. No audit implications expected; external reviewers have been notified. Context for the next agenda item follows.

confidential, kagep-kahof: Druokax Systems plans to lower the Ulaath list price by 53 percent in March.

This change replaces the naive fingerprint matcher in the Quellbird alert deduplicator with a sliding-window similarity check (120s window, 0.85 threshold). I've verified that paging behavior is unchanged for singleton alerts and that storm scenarios from the Haverlake incident replay collapse from 340 pages to 12. Remaining risk: cross-region clock skew could split windows; mitigation documented in the design note. Please review the threshold constants carefully. Sign-off on this change is required from the engineer named below.

account owner for bawip-tahag: Raleth Quenok

For the weekly eng sync: we identified configuration drift between the Meridly sync workers in the Holtsford and Braywick regions. Holtsford workers were updated to the new conflict-resolution policy (last-writer-wins with tombstone checks), while Braywick still runs the legacy merge behavior. The result is duplicate and ghost events for tenants whose calendars replicate across both regions. Remediation is to re-pin Braywick to the shared baseline and redeploy. The baseline configuration that both regions should converge on is shown below.

settings of yadup-tajef:
[pelys]
team = raleth
access_code = ac_67f5a1
host = pelys.olvarqlabs.local
port = 8080
owner = pramir.pramir
peer = rusir.qirvanio.corp